[PATCH net] rxrpc: Fix error when reading rxrpc tokens

When converting from ASSERTCMP to WARN_ON, the tested condition must
be inverted, which was missed for this case.

This would cause an EIO error when trying to read an rxrpc token, for
instance when trying to display tokens with AuriStor's "tokens" command.

Fixes: 84924aac08a4 ("rxrpc: Fix checker warning")

---
 net/rxrpc/key.c |    2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/net/rxrpc/key.c b/net/rxrpc/key.c
index 8d53aded09c4..33e8302a79e3 100644
--- a/net/rxrpc/key.c
+++ b/net/rxrpc/key.c
@@ -680,7 +680,7 @@ static long rxrpc_read(const struct key *key,
 			return -ENOPKG;
 		}
 
-		if (WARN_ON((unsigned long)xdr - (unsigned long)oldxdr ==
+		if (WARN_ON((unsigned long)xdr - (unsigned long)oldxdr !=
 			    toksize))
 			return -EIO;
 	}
